1. Consumer psychology: what it is and how it emerged -- 2. Consumer memory and learning -- 3. Perception and attention -- 4. Identity and consumption -- 5. The emotional consumer -- 6. Attitudes -- 7. Advertising psychology -- 8. Motivational determinants of consumer behaviour -- 9. Consumer decision-making and brand loyalty -- 10. The Internet -- 11. Children as consumers -- 12. Consumption and happiness -- 13. Consumers and the environment
"Psychology is central to an effective understanding of consumption behaviours. The aim of this book is to provide an overall understanding for why people consume certain products and services and how this affects their behaviour and psychological well being"--Provided by publisher
